WebCorrective actions can be: Informal discussions on the employee’s work, attendance, or in-office conduct. Verbal warnings. Written letters detailing employee’s work, attendance, or conduct—with an expectation and guidelines for improvement. Corrective vs. Disciplinary Actions. A disciplinary action is guided towards misconduct such as theft, or violence, whereas a corrective action is based on performance (how the employee performs their duties). The easiest way to think about it is: Corrective Action = Performance. Disciplinary Action = Misconduct.
